10.31训练日记

之前的树状数组看完了,那个RMQ也快了,其实基本上都是实现短时间内的查询的,不过有的是前缀和,

还有就是,做了的题目,有一些还是不怎么明白的,其中还有什么离散化,归并什么的,没怎么看,也没看懂,

今天的话,训练赛上,有个题目,很早就出了思路,模拟栈操作的一个吧,其实差不多的,用栈写起来还挺好挺方便的,但是涉及到查找和删除找到的元素前面的所有元素的时候,我一心想着用String中的find函数和截取字符串函数,其实的话,效果也不错的,后面的我网上找了一下那个题目,没有这样写的,自己提交了一下还是能过几个点的,后面的几个点过不了了就,TLE,但是感觉String还是挺快的,思路的话,也还可以,挺简单的一道题目,虽然用string中函数的方法是过不了的,

但是今天还是犯了傻,就是那个字符串截取函数的头文件是<string>这个很久没用了吧应该是,就忘了加,我在编译器上是能跑的,但是到了提交的时候就说我是CE,CE了很多遍,也没看出来,还是最后和老段交流吐苦水的时候他给我发现的,给他笑坏了,

还是很傻的,这种失误,心态崩盘的,其实早点用模拟栈或者直接用栈操作加一个标记数组很快就能做出来的,就是不想用标记数组,最后还是用上了,真的香~

综合这3.4天的还有之前的学习吧,觉得交流思路是个好东西,我和老段的话,一个宿舍的,当时也没想着商量商量看一个地方的,结果学的东西就暂时不同了,其实觉得还是学一个地方是好的,平时我在宿舍看数据结构的时候他也会过来看看心态崩盘的我有什么问题,有些东西交流起来就没有那么复杂了,不过的话,平日里也会问一下最近学到的什么东西比较难,什么东西比较巧妙什么的,可能暂时不学,但是这样交流起来的,也算是一种对自己掌握知识的炫耀吧,这样也有动力,别再下次的时候一问学了什么人家说一堆,我什么都说不说出口,讨论真的是个好东西,

看着我现在的进度,应该是拖后了,一天不会有72小时,我要快点看,√

 

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值